0


git在项目中拉取/切换项目的操作教程

1.首先打开安装并在对应文件夹中打开git

在这里插入图片描述

2.进去你所要拉取的项目(像gitee、github),我用的是github,都是一样的,将项目的https拖拽下来,然后在终端输入git clone 项目https地址

在这里插入图片描述

git clone 我的项目地址

3.进入项目文件加创建本地分支

cd miao-plugin  #进入
git branch  #查看分支
git checkout -b dev  #创建dev分支
git fetch origin dev#拉取分支到本地git pull --set-upstream origin dev  #远程加载指令

在这里插入图片描述

git branch  #再次查看分支 会多一个dev

4.且换分支并合并代

git checkout dev  #切换分支到dev
git pull origin dev  #将远程指定分支 拉取到 本地指定分支

在这里插入图片描述

5.切换分支

git checkout master

在这里插入图片描述

Q:无法拉取dev分支

* branch dev -> FETCH_HEAD 
error: Your local changes to the following files

解决:

git checkout .

Q: git pull 报错 Your configuration specifies to merge with the ref

git remote prune origin #会与远程库进行一次同步,最终清理掉版本库中的分支,但本地工作区中的分支并不会删除 

Q:解决首次拉取远程分支出现(分支|MERGING)

#重置节点git reset --hard head#强制删除分支。因为没有解决冲突,所以无法使用-d删除git branch -D dev
#删除完异常分支后,需要重新checkout到develop分支:#确定develop的位置git branch -a
#checkout与pull对应的develop分支git checkout -b develop origin/develop
#检查提交日志git log
#时间对得上,完成
标签: git github

本文转载自: https://blog.csdn.net/Houaki/article/details/129028211
版权归原作者 Nekoosu 所有, 如有侵权,请联系我们删除。

“git在项目中拉取/切换项目的操作教程”的评论:

还没有评论